Tinkoff Journal author Dasha Leizarenko experimented with the Midjourney neural network and created Images from the TV series “One of Us” set in the USSR. In the “Soviet” version, the planet was engulfed by a parsnip epidemic, while in the original show it was a cordyceps fungus.

The author used the fifth version of the Midjourney neural network, which can generate realistic images from a textual description. He added the word “soviet” to each request and set a 3:2 aspect ratio. He added the phrase “film photo” or “taken by Andrei Tarkovsky” to the end of his request to add more atmosphere to the paintings.

Moreover, as Leizarenko points out, he did not give detailed descriptions of zombies and heroes, as he wanted to see unexpected details. The author described Soviet architecture in more detail.

Leizarenko also added that the “Soviet” Joel and Ellie appeared almost instantly, and attempts to improve them did not bring success to the author. In total, the curious posted 14 pictures.
